Get instant access to video lessons taught by experienced investment bankers. Learn financial …Dividend Payout Ratio = Dividends ÷ Net Income. For example, if a company issued $20 million in dividends in the current period with $100 million in net income, the payout ratio would be 20%. Payout Ratio = $20m ÷ $100m = 20%. Notice in the Weighted Average Cost of Capital (WACC) formula above that the cost of debt is adjusted lower to reflect the company’s tax rate. Most financial institutions will provide new hires with Series 7 study materials and will encourage them to allocate ...To calculate the paid-in-kind interest, the formula consists of the PIK rate being multiplied by the beginning balance of the applicable debt security or preferred equity. PIK Interest = PIK Interest Rate (%) x Beginning of Period Balance of PIK Debt. Note that if there are mandatory repayments (i.e. principal amortization) associated with the ...
